Overview

The ASUS ROG Strix XG27UCG-W 27-inch 4K HDR Gaming Monitor is built for serious gamers looking for top-tier performance. This monitor offers an impressive 27-inch display with 4K resolution, delivering crisp and vibrant visuals. It supports an ultra-fast 160Hz refresh rate at 4K and a 320Hz refresh rate at FHD, making it ideal for competitive gaming. With Fast IPS technology, the monitor ensures sharp images and fluid motion, while the G-SYNC compatibility and ELMB Sync work together to eliminate tearing and ghosting, providing a seamless gaming experience. Whether for casual play or high-stakes esports, this monitor is a top contender.

Specifications

  • Screen Size: 27 inches diagonal display for expansive, immersive viewing.
  • Resolution: 4K UHD (3840 x 2160) for sharp, detailed visuals.
  • Refresh Rate: 160Hz at 4K and 320Hz at Full HD for ultra-smooth gaming performance.
  • Response Time: 1ms response time to reduce motion blur and ghosting for fast-paced gaming.
  • Panel Type: Fast IPS technology for vibrant colors and quick response times.
  • Color Gamut: 95% DCI-P3 color coverage for accurate and vivid color reproduction.
  • NVIDIA G-SYNC: Compatible with NVIDIA G-SYNC for tear-free and stutter-free gaming.
  • ELMB Sync: ELMB Sync reduces motion blur and ghosting during fast action sequences.
  • Ports: Includes 3 USB 3.0 ports for easy connectivity with external devices.
  • Software: DisplayWidget Center software allows easy access to monitor settings and adjustments.
  • Aspect Ratio: 16:9 aspect ratio provides a widescreen view, ideal for gaming and multimedia.
  • Connectivity: Supports HDMI, DisplayPort, and USB ports for versatile device connections.
  • VESA Compatibility: Compatible with VESA mounts for flexible mounting options.
  • Design: Sleek white design with thin bezels, ideal for modern gaming setups.
  • Warranty: Comes with a 3-year warranty for peace of mind and product protection.
  • Power Consumption: Typical power consumption is around 45W, with an energy-efficient design.
  • Viewing Angle: Wide 178° horizontal and vertical viewing angles for consistent picture quality.
  • Brightness: Supports up to 600 nits peak brightness for HDR content and bright environments.
  • Weight: Weighs approximately 6.6 kg, making it moderately heavy but stable for desk setups.

The 1ms response time ensures that there is minimal lag between your actions and the monitor's display, which is crucial for competitive gaming where every millisecond counts. It helps to reduce ghosting and blurring, providing a sharper, more responsive gaming experience.

NVIDIA G-SYNC synchronizes the monitor's refresh rate with the frame rate of your GPU, reducing screen tearing and stuttering. This results in smoother, more immersive visuals, especially during fast-paced gaming sessions.

ELMB Sync reduces ghosting and motion blur, especially in fast-moving scenes, by allowing the backlight strobing feature to work in sync with G-SYNC. This results in clearer, smoother visuals during high-speed gaming.

While this monitor is designed primarily for high-performance PC gaming, it works well with consoles that support 4K output. However, note that the full 160Hz refresh rate is only available with PC setups, while console gamers will typically experience 60Hz or 120Hz depending on their console.
